September 2009 Griffin takes the world (2425 kb) Lopez Group companies are known for being leaders in their field. There's FirstGen in power generation, Energy Development Corporation in geothermal power, and ABS-CBN in broadcasting, just to name a few. but not many are aware that another Lopez Group company is the top-drawer name when it comes to travel specifically marine crew travel: Griffin Sierra Travel Inc. (GSTI).

July 2009 Generation Next (2085 kb) Eugenio H. Lopez has 22 grandchildren -13 of whom now work for the Lopez Group and in time will run it. His grandchildren say that their work today gives them a new way to connect with their grandfather and his values. Don Eugenio has been gone for 34 years, but something of his spirit still remains in the institutions he left behind.

May 2009  Gina Lopez leads "one big push" to clean up the Pasig River (2669 kb) In 1999, ABS-CBN Foundation Inc. (AFI) did the near impossible when it successfully took on the management of the reforestation of the La Mesa Watershed area through its then newly formed environmental arm, Bantay Kalikasan.

March 2009  FPSC: Bullish on solar energy (3477 kb) The future's bright for First Philec Solar Corporation (FPSC) and its trailblazing incursion into the sunrise industry of solar power. An 80-20 joint venture between First Philippine Electric Corporation and Sun Power Philippines Manufacturing Ltd. (SPML), FPSC came about after a series of fortuitous events.
